Does anyone know where I can get a leflunomide level done? For those of you
who are unaware of this drug (I was until yesterday) it is one of the newer
treatments for rheumatic disease, it has a long half live and is teratogenic.
The reason for the request is that we have a patient commenced on this drug
(in another country) and when our rheumatologists took over her care she was
found to be pregnant. All information we have recommends treatment with
cholestyramine to enhance elimination and recommends monitoring to ensure
elimination – but doesn’t mention where to get the level done.
